About this earthquake

On August 9, 2025 at 09:40 UTC, a magnitude M5.0 earthquake occurred near OFF EAST COAST OF KAMCHATKA. With a focal depth of about 50 km, this was a shallow earthquake, whose shaking is usually felt more strongly at the surface. Earthquakes of this magnitude can damage poorly built structures.

Why depth matters

Shallow quakes release energy near the surface — shaking is felt more strongly and damage potential is higher.
